ConAgra Brands reported adjusted earnings per share of $0.39 for the first quarter of fiscal 2026,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.4044 by 3.56%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release. Despite the earnings miss, the stock rose 1.35% in after‑market trading, suggesting that investors focused on other qualitative factors or had already priced in a weaker result.

ConAgra’s Q1 performance was pressured by a challenging consumer environment and lingering cost headwinds. The adjusted EPS of $0.39 reflects the impact of promotional investments aimed at driving volume recovery in key categories such as frozen foods and snacks. While specific revenue data were not provided, management likely noted that organic volumes remained soft as shoppers continued to trade down or seek value alternatives. Gross margins may have been squeezed by elevated input costs for commodities like wheat and edible oils, as well as higher logistics expenses. The company’s cost‑savings initiatives, including supply chain optimization and SKU rationalization, are expected to provide gradual relief but have yet to fully offset these pressures. Segment‑level performance was mixed, with the Grocery & Snacks division benefiting from steady at‑home consumption, while the Frozen segment faced intensified competition and promotional activity. Operating expenses remained under control, but the earnings miss underscores the difficulty of balancing margin protection with volume‑recovery efforts in a fragile macroeconomic backdrop.

ConAgra did not issue formal guidance revisions alongside this release, though the earnings miss may temper near‑term expectations. Management has previously emphasized a focus on brand investment and innovation to reignite top‑line growth, particularly in higher‑margin products. The company anticipates that its portfolio realignment—including recent divestitures and category pruning—will sharpen its competitive positioning. However, risk factors remain significant: persistent inflation could further pressure consumer spending, while commodity price volatility may continue to compress margins. Additionally, the ongoing shift toward private‑label alternatives in several categories poses a threat to branded market share. ConAgra’s strategic priorities include accelerating digital shelf capabilities and expanding distribution in the convenience channel. Investors should watch for any updates on the company’s cost‑out program and potential impact from foreign exchange fluctuations. Without explicit revenue data, the market will look to upcoming quarters for clearer signals on demand trends and margin recovery.

The 1.35% stock price increase following an earnings miss indicates that the market may have considered the shortfall manageable or already discounted. Some analysts view the results as a reflection of broader industry headwinds rather than company‑specific issues, and they may adjust their full‑year estimates downward moderately. Others note that ConAgra’s valuation already incorporates cautious consumer trends, leaving limited downside if volumes stabilize. Key factors to monitor in the coming quarters include the pace of volume recovery in core frozen categories, gross margin trajectory, and any update on fiscal 2026 guidance. Should revenue trends improve or cost savings accelerate, the stock could see upward revisions. Conversely, further margin erosion or a deeper consumer slowdown would heighten risk. The next earnings report will be critical for confirming whether the Q1 miss was a temporary bump or the start of a more persistent downturn.
